独立站组件代码集成指南
2025-12-31 1掌握独立站组件代码的正确使用方式,是提升转化率与运营效率的核心技能。
理解独立站组件代码的本质与作用
独立站组件代码是指嵌入在网站前端或后台的一段JavaScript、HTML或CSS脚本,用于实现特定功能模块,如购物车、支付网关、客服系统、营销弹窗、物流追踪等。根据Shopify 2023年度开发者报告,超过78%的功能扩展通过组件代码实现,平均每个独立站加载6.3个第三方组件。这些代码通常由SaaS服务商(如Yotpo、Klaviyo、Loox)提供,需精准部署至主题文件或页面标签中。错误嵌入会导致页面崩溃、SEO降权或数据丢失。Google Core Web Vitals数据显示,每增加1个未优化的组件,首屏加载延迟提升180ms,直接影响跳出率。
主流组件类型与最佳实践标准
按功能划分,独立站常用组件包括:营销类(邮件订阅、倒计时弹窗)、信任类(评价插件、安全徽章)、交易类(多币种切换、一键加购)、分析类(Google Analytics 4、Meta Pixel)。据BuiltWith 2024年Q1跨境电商技术栈统计,Top 10,000独立站中,91.3%使用至少一个第三方评价组件,其中Judge.me和Loox合计占比达67%。最佳部署位置为</body>标签前或Liquid模板的theme.liquid文件底部,确保异步加载(async/defer属性)。权威测试表明,采用异步加载可使LCP(最大内容绘制)指标改善23%-35%(来源:Web.dev Performance Benchmarks, 2023)。
安全合规与性能优化策略
组件代码必须符合GDPR、CCPA等隐私法规要求。所有含用户行为追踪的脚本需通过Cookie同意管理平台(如Cookiebot、OneTrust)进行条件触发。据ECOMMPAY《2023跨境支付合规白皮书》,因未合规处理跟踪代码导致的罚款案例同比增长41%。性能方面,建议启用代码压缩工具(如Terser),合并冗余请求,并设置资源预加载(preload)。Shopify官方推荐将非关键组件延迟至页面空闲期加载(使用requestIdleCallback),实测可降低CLS(累积布局偏移)0.15以上,达到Core Web Vitals“良好”阈值。
常见问题解答
Q1:如何验证组件代码是否成功运行?
A1:检查浏览器控制台无报错并确认功能生效 ——
- 打开Chrome开发者工具 → Console面板
- 刷新页面,查看是否有红色错误提示
- 执行组件提供的测试方法或触发其UI元素
Q2:组件导致页面变慢怎么办?
A2:优先隔离并优化高耗时脚本 ——
- 使用Lighthouse检测各组件加载耗时
- 将非核心组件改为动态导入或延迟加载
- 联系供应商获取轻量化版本或API替代方案
Q3:能否同时安装多个同类组件?
A3:不建议,易引发冲突且损害用户体验 ——
- 保留转化率最高的单一组件
- 通过A/B测试对比不同组件效果
- 使用Tag Manager集中管理调用逻辑
Q4:更换主题后组件失效如何处理?
A4:需重新嵌入并适配新DOM结构 ——
- 导出原主题中的组件代码片段
- 对照新主题布局文件定位插入位置
- 调整选择器或回调函数以匹配新元素
Q5:如何更新过时的组件代码?
A5:遵循版本迭代规范避免服务中断 ——
- 备份当前代码并在测试环境验证新版
- 替换旧脚本并监控错误日志24小时
- 通知团队成员更新相关操作文档
精准集成,持续优化,让每一行代码驱动增长。

